pauldg

Nov 18, 2005, 12:32 PM
the ericsson is a good bit smaller and feels and looks slightly better built.

Nokia sent me the 6102 with a BT adapter (i have no idea what thats worth) and many on HoFo were happy about the adapter, but i saw this as an admission that they should've invluded BT in the phone in the 1st place.

anyway that's something SE got right. The screen on the z520 is nicer than the 6102.

i really haven't used either one of the 2, just to make a test call and to see if their speakerphones are available while ringing, i.e. before the other end picks up (and they are BOTH capable of that)

i will say that when playing around with the SE, i cupped my hand around the loop antenna and the phone dropped like all signal strength - then again i just ...
